如何在本地搭建PPPOE服务器:安全风险与实践步骤

需积分: 12 12 下载量 67 浏览量 更新于2024-09-17 收藏 177KB DOC 举报
"本文主要介绍了如何架设PPPOE服务器,包括PPPOE的基本概念、工作原理以及如何利用RASPPPOE_099和Windows Server 2003的路由与远程访问功能来搭建自己的PPPOE服务器。" 在IT领域中,PPPOE(Point-to-Point Protocol Over Ethernet)是一种广泛应用于ADSL和FTTx+LAN接入方式的网络协议。它允许用户通过以太网连接模拟拨号到互联网服务提供商(ISP)的服务器,从而获取网络访问权限。PPPOE结合了以太网的物理层和PPP(点对点协议)的控制层,为用户提供了一种灵活且安全的接入方式。 PPPOE的验证过程分为两个阶段:发现阶段和PPP阶段。在发现阶段,客户端通过广播寻找附近的PPPOE服务器并确定会话ID,这一阶段类似于DHCP的发现过程。在PPP阶段,客户端与服务器之间建立PPP连接,分配IP资源,进行身份验证,通常使用CHAP或PAP等安全协议。 文章提到,由于PPPOE的广播特性,本地可以架设一个PPPOE服务器来捕获同一网络下的用户验证信息。这揭示了PPPOE的安全隐患,即如果有人在本地网络中架设非法服务器,可能会窃取其他用户的账号和密码。 为了架设PPPOE服务器,作者推荐使用RASPPPOE_099,这是一个开源的PPPOE服务器软件,以及Windows Server 2003的路由与远程访问服务。步骤通常包括安装和配置RASPPPOE,设置网络参数,然后启用Windows Server 2003的路由与远程访问功能,将服务器配置为PPPOE接入点。这样,网络中的其他设备就会尝试连接到这个本地服务器进行身份验证。 值得注意的是,非法架设PPPOE服务器是不道德且可能违法的行为,本文的目的在于教育读者理解PPPOE的工作原理和潜在风险,而不是鼓励不正当的网络行为。在实际操作中,应确保遵循网络安全法规,保护用户隐私。